  1. Is homeownership only for the wealthy? Seattle buyers now need $182K income, study finds
    If you’re hoping to buy a home in Seattle, a new Redfin analysis says you now need about $182,766 in annual income, far above the city’s median of $131,906. KIRO’s Gee and Ursula Show unpacks how rising prices, steep monthly payments, and maintenance costs are pushing many working residents to feel homeownership is only for the wealthy.

  2. Seattle’s last ‘Gang of Four’ activist honored at Fort Lawton ceremony
    Seattle civil-rights veteran Larry Gossett returned to Discovery Park this weekend to mark 56 years since activists occupied Fort Lawton and helped secure land for the Daybreak Star Indian Cultural Center. The commemoration highlighted how Native and Black organizers in Seattle joined forces in 1970, reshaping local civil rights history and creating a lasting cultural home for Indigenous communities.

  3. Seattle, WA: Driver on Greenwood & 90th Blatantly Runs Red After 10 Seconds, Treats Red Light Like A 4-Way Stop
    A Greenwood driver’s dashcam captured another motorist treating the red light at Greenwood Avenue North and North 90th Street like a four-way stop, rolling through after about 10 seconds. The clip, shared to Reddit, has locals shaking their heads and highlights that red-light violations in Seattle can bring a roughly $139 civil fine through Seattle Municipal Court, even without license points.

  4. The Museum of Flight Expands Aviation Education Model Through Peninsula School District Partnership
    Seattle’s Museum of Flight is growing its Aeronautical Science Pathway program, using its Seattle-based aviation curriculum to help Peninsula School District launch a no-cost Aviation Academy for high schoolers. Students can earn up to 60 college credits, connect with Seattle-Tacoma International Airport professionals, and explore aviation careers through this expanding regional partnership.

  5. Southwest’s Austin lounge, Southwest’s assigned seating learning curve, Virgin Atlantic’s new app, and a TSA-free flight in the PNW (Saturday Selection)
    Seattle travelers will soon be able to skip TSA lines by flying a new SeaPort route between Boeing Field and Spokane’s Felts Field on a nine-passenger plane. The roundup also touches on Southwest’s boarding changes, a possible new Austin lounge, and Virgin Atlantic’s revamped app, but the most immediately useful news for locals is this easier Seattle–Spokane hop.
